Output af8ae3101a6b02ec9a149fd7df095ae0350a4a29db321e84582b01d19aba1808:34

value
500829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ee479488c776d9a0c82e27e9f78efb18c73ef95 OP_EQUAL
address
34WMtw8MmDfHok561VrcLPJfxcmnHcz7CR
transaction
af8ae3101a6b02ec9a149fd7df095ae0350a4a29db321e84582b01d19aba1808